CSS scroll snapping allows you to lock the viewport to certain elements or locations after a user has finished scrolling. This browser support data is from Caniusewhich has more detail. A number indicates that browser supports the feature at that version and up.
Example: In this code, use of these three properties is shown and button shift to the bottom left corner of the div element. Example: In this code, below use of this three property is shown and button shift to the bottom right corner of the div element. If you like GeeksforGeeks and would like to contribute, you can also write an article using contribute.
Set the footer coding to "bottom" for it to stay at the bottom of the Web page. A website footer may appear in the middle of the Web page and not on the bottom for a number of reasons. One of the most common is that the website content is small and the footer is pushed up to the middle. The " " containers with the footer may be coded incorrectly, the margins or padding may be wrong and the "float" property could be wrong.
You need the whole web page—or at least more than one small part of it. So short of the arduous process of scrolling down a page at a time, capturing one window screenshot again and again, then cobbling it all together at the end—what are your options? Here's the shortcut to getting a full-page screenshot in Chrome without having to install any extension or tool.
The vertical-align CSS property sets vertical alignment of an inline or table-cell box. Note that vertical-align only applies to inline and table-cell elements: you can't use it to vertically align block-level elements. Get the latest and greatest from MDN delivered straight to your inbox.
Deprecated This feature is no longer recommended. Though some browsers might still support it, it may have already been removed from the relevant web standards, may be in the process of being dropped, or may only be kept for compatibility purposes. Avoid using it, and update existing code if possible; see the compatibility table at the bottom of this page to guide your decision. Be aware that this feature may cease to work at any time.
When implemented irresponsibly it can become extremely annoying and give a very bad browsing experience to the user. When done right though, it can be a great way to display things like image galleries. The good news too is that browsers are still in control and can make a judgment call as to wether a snap point should be respected, given how the user is scrolling.